Original book introduction: About the Original Book In the book "Disloyal: A Memoir: The True Story of the Former Personal Attorney to President Donald J. Trump" by Michael Cohen, Cohen an American attorney and businessman. Who acted as Special Counsel to President Donald J. Trump from 2017-2018 and as Executive VP for the Trump Organization writes about Trump's racist rants against President Barack Obama, Nelson Mandela, and Black and Hispanic people in general, as well as the cruelty, humiliation, and abuse he leveled at family and staff.
The book also exposes the fact that Trump engaged in tax fraud by inflating his wealth or electronic fraud by rigging an online survey, or outing Trump's Neanderthal views towards women or his hush-money payments to clandestine lovers. It also went ahead to describe Trump as a con man who will do or say absolutely anything to win, regardless of the cost to his family, associates, or his country.

Insights from Chapter 1
#1
President Donald Trump is a man who sees everything as an opportunity for personal gain, and he has a history of using his wealth, power, and celebrity to get whatever he wants.
#2
Trump’s nearly constant use of the word great
is not a myth – that is how he talks. Hyperbole is his instinctual method of communication, exaggerating his own talents and wealth and physical characteristics and achievements, as if by enlarging things he could make them real.
#3
Trump didn’t actually own Trump Mortgage. Like many of his
businesses, there was a licensing agreement, paying Trump royalties for the use of his name, a structure which shielded him from liability, but also meant he had no equity in the business.
#4
Working for Trump, Michael Cohen was made to cross moral, ethical, and ultimately criminal boundaries. Trump began by testing his fealty and submissiveness, the way a gang leader assesses a new recruit, giving the wannabe small crimes to commit to see how loyal he is.
